Inexpensive Ingredients for Homemade Serum

Creating a homemade serum for skincare is easier than you might think, and it can be a cost-effective way to pamper your skin. By using simple and affordable ingredients, you can customize your serum to target specific skin concerns and achieve the results you desire. Here are some inexpensive ingredients that can be used to make a homemade serum:

1. Rosehip Seed Oil

Rosehip seed oil is a popular ingredient in Skincare Products due to its moisturizing and anti-aging properties. Rich in vitamins A and C, antioxidants, and essential fatty acids, rosehip seed oil can help improve skin tone, texture, and elasticity. It is suitable for all skin types, including sensitive and acne-prone skin.

2. Jojoba oil

Jojoba oil is a lightweight and non-comedogenic oil that closely resembles the natural oils produced by the skin. It can help balance oil production, hydrate the skin, and prevent clogged pores. Jojoba oil is suitable for all skin types and can be used to soothe and protect the skin.

3. Vitamin E Oil

Vitamin E oil is a powerful antioxidant that can help protect the skin from damage caused by free radicals. It also has anti-inflammatory properties that can soothe and repair the skin. Vitamin E oil can be beneficial for dry, mature, or sun-damaged skin.

4. Lavender Essential Oil

Lavender essential oil is known for its calming and healing properties. It can help reduce inflammation, soothe irritation, and promote skin regeneration. Lavender essential oil is suitable for all skin types and can be used to create a relaxing and rejuvenating serum.

How to Make Homemade Serum

Making a homemade serum is simple and requires only a few ingredients. To create your customized serum, you will need a few key ingredients, a dark glass bottle for storage, and a dropper for easy application. Here is a basic recipe for a homemade serum using the inexpensive ingredients mentioned above:

  1. Combine 1 tablespoon of rosehip seed oil, 1 tablespoon of Jojoba oil, and a few drops of vitamin E oil in a dark glass bottle.
  2. Add 5-10 drops of lavender essential oil to the mixture and shake well to blend the ingredients.
  3. Store the serum in a cool, dark place away from direct sunlight.
  4. To use, apply a few drops of the serum to clean skin and gently massage it in using upward and outward motions.
  5. Follow with your favorite moisturizer or sunscreen.
